> Which brings the subject back to
> music-- does anyone have any info.  that there was a Real World song
> that begins "Oh the World Owes Me a Living..."

Yep. It was the Grasshopper's theme song, in the animated Silly Symphony,
"The Grasshopper and the Ants". He sang the song a couple of times in the
short, to help establish his lazy character.

The Grasshopper was voiced by Pinto Colvig, who was the original voice of
Goofy, so Goofy also sang/hummed/mumbled the song in a few of his shorts,
although the only lyrics Goofy sang were,

"Oh, the world owes me a livin',
Deedle-diedle-dadle-diedle-dum - hyuk!"
